Columbia Names Wisner Producer, Artist

NEW YORK—Jimmy Wisner, whose arrangements have been heard on numerous hit disks, has joined Columbia Records as a pop A&R producer and artist.

Wisner, also a writer, reached a peak of success late last year when seven records with his arrangements appeared on the best-selling charts. He reports to Jack Gold, vp in charge of A&R at the label.

Wisner joins Columbia with almost 12 years of indie arranging, producing and writing. His gold record associations include “1-2-3” by Len Barry, “The Rain, the Park & Other Things” by the Cowsills and “I Think We’re Alone Now” by Tommy James.

Other artists who have recorded with his arrangements include Ed Ames, Jerry Butler, A1 Hirt, Jay & the Techniques, Miriam Makeba, Herbie Mann, Marilyn Maye and Spanky & Our Gang. Barbra Streisand’s current ColumWa single, “Our Corner of the Night,” was arranged by Wisner. He also produced recordings by Len Barry, Robert Cameron, and Gloria Lynn.

Kornfeld’s most recent triumphs as a producer-writer were disk successes by the Cowsills, MGM’s family act. He and writer Steve Duboff penned the team’s first two hits, “The Rain, the Park & Other Things” and “We Can Fly.”
